Landmark Legal Reforms Proposed for LGBTQ+ Community in India
Significant strides towards equality may soon be on the horizon for the LGBTQ+ community in India. Following the Supreme Court’s 2023 deliberations on same-sex marriage, a government-appointed panel is now reviewing a policy brief advocating for substantial changes to existing laws.
Proposed Reforms Aim to Address Key Concerns
The policy brief highlights crucial areas needing reform to ensure equal rights and protections for LGBTQ+ individuals. These areas include marriage, succession, criminal law, and tenancy rights. The proposed changes seek to address long-standing disparities and discrimination faced by the community.
Supreme Court Prompted Government Action
The impetus for these proposed reforms stems from the Supreme Court’s acknowledgment of the issues facing the LGBTQ+ community during the 2023 same-sex marriage case. The Court’s intervention led to the formation of the government panel tasked with exploring solutions and recommending necessary legal changes.
